#!/usr/bin/env node /** * Claude Flow Agent Router * Routes tasks to optimal agents based on learned patterns */ const AGENT_CAPABILITIES = { coder: ['code-generation', 'refactoring', 'debugging', 'implementation'], tester: ['unit-testing', 'integration-testing', 'coverage', 'test-generation'], reviewer: ['code-review', 'security-audit', 'quality-check', 'best-practices'], researcher: ['web-search', 'documentation', 'analysis', 'summarization'], architect: ['system-design', 'architecture', 'patterns', 'scalability'], 'backend-dev': ['api', 'database', 'server', 'authentication'], 'frontend-dev': ['ui', 'react', 'css', 'components'], devops: ['ci-cd', 'docker', 'deployment', 'infrastructure'], }; const TASK_PATTERNS = { // Code patterns 'implement|create|build|add|write code': 'coder', 'test|spec|coverage|unit test|integration': 'tester', 'review|audit|check|validate|security': 'reviewer', 'research|find|search|documentation|explore': 'researcher', 'design|architect|structure|plan': 'architect', // Domain patterns 'api|endpoint|server|backend|database': 'backend-dev', 'ui|frontend|component|react|css|style': 'frontend-dev', 'deploy|docker|ci|cd|pipeline|infrastructure': 'devops', }; function routeTask(task) { const taskLower = task.toLowerCase(); // Check patterns for (const [pattern, agent] of Object.entries(TASK_PATTERNS)) { const regex = new RegExp(pattern, 'i'); if (regex.test(taskLower)) { return { agent, confidence: 0.8, reason: `Matched pattern: ${pattern}`, }; } } // Default to coder for unknown tasks return { agent: 'coder', confidence: 0.5, reason: 'Default routing - no specific pattern matched', }; } // CLI const task = process.argv.slice(2).join(' '); if (task) { const result = routeTask(task); console.log(JSON.stringify(result, null, 2)); } else { console.log('Usage: router.js '); console.log('\nAvailable agents:', Object.keys(AGENT_CAPABILITIES).join(', ')); } module.exports = { routeTask, AGENT_CAPABILITIES, TASK_PATTERNS };
